What companies run services between Disneyland Paris, France and Saint-Michel Notre-Dame, France?

Réseau Express Régional (RER Paris) operates a train from Marne-la-Vallée - Chessy to Châtelet - Les Halles every 10 minutes. Tickets cost €5–7 and the journey takes 39 min. Alternatively, you can take a vehicle from Disneyland Paris to Notre-Dame - Quai de Montebello via Chessy South Bus Station, Paris - Bercy-Seine Bus Station, and Gare de Bercy in around 1h 17m.
